The inspector’s account

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Zabel Chochian conducted a Required annual inspection visit. The LPA met with staff and assistant Administrator Marina Karina Antig.

At approximately 12pm., the LPA and Ms. Antig toured the physical plant areas inside and outside to ensure there are no health and safety hazards and facility is in compliance with Title 22 Regulations.

KITCHEN : Kitchen knives are stored locked and inaccessible in the kitchen cabinet under the sink. The supply of perishable and nonperishable food is adequate. The supply of dishes is adequate. Appliances in the kitchen were clean and appeared functional. There is a sufficient supply of emergency food and water. Ms. Antig was advised to separate the emergency food supply from their daily supply use.

BEDROOMS : There are (7) seven bedrooms in the facility; the facility licensed with four (4) private bedrooms for resident use, (1) shared bedroom for resident use and (1) one staff room. During todays visit LPA observed an additional resident bedroom. Ms. Antig explained that they added a dry wall in the living room. main This room and created an additional bedroom after licensure. All resident rooms have direct access to the outside except for the newly added room. Lighting in the rooms appeared adequate; rooms were set up with all required furniture. BATHROOMS : There are (2) two full bathrooms and (1) one half bath for resident use; the half bathroom near the entrance of the main hallway at the entrance of the home is designated for and guests. The bathroom located in the hallway observed ceiling in needed of patching and paint; also the base board in this bathroom also need to be repaired/painted (rusted/in disrepair). Staff have a private staff bathroom located next to the Staff room. COMMON AREA: The common areas were appropriately furnished, and the lighting was adequate. There is a television and other entertainment equipment in the living room area. The facility smoke alarm system is hard wired; the smoke detectors were operable at the time of the visit. Fire extinguisher observed fully charged and last serviced in 05/2024. There is a functioning telephone on the premises. Emergency exiting plans/sketch are posted. Emergency telephone numbers are posted in hallway bulletin board.Other required postings are also posted in the main hallway bulletin board.
